Giorgia Meloni Sparks Controversy
During a sweltering summer day in 2024, Italy’s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ni captured attention with her daring and divisive statements at a press briefing. Meloni addressed the topic of violence against women in Italy, stating that she may be labeled as a racist for pointing out that foreigners are disproportionately involved in violent crimes against women. The declaration prompted a quick discussion in both Italy and across the globe, leading to inquiries about the relationship between freedom of expression, societal obligations, and racial bias.
The Background of the Assertion
Meloni responded to a series of violent acts against women in Italy, which included prominent cases involving immigrants. The Prime Minister stressed her dedication to safeguarding women and ensuring that the nation’s legal system stays alert in combating gender-based violence. Nonetheless, she also highlighted that a notable amount of these offenses were allegedly carried out by individuals who are not Italian citizens.
During the discussion, Meloni pointed out data indicating that individuals from Africa and the Middle East, especially foreigners, made up a larger proportion of suspects in violent crimes against women than expected. According to Meloni, these statistics justified a deeper discussion about immigration policies, integration, and the societal and cultural factors that may be fueling this violence.
Nevertheless, her comments were quickly met with strong opposition. Critics, such as human rights groups and political rivals, alleged that she promoted racial stereotypes and exploited gender-based violence to advance her political goal of tightening immigration policies.

The Political Environment
Meloni’s statement, which has sparked controversy, must be considered within the context of Italy’s overall political environment. As the head of the far-right party Fratelli d’Italia, Meloni has continuously supported more stringent immigration policies, such as enhanced border security and steps to reduce the intake of asylum seekers. Her positions have gained her significant backing from nationalist organizations and harsh disapproval from proponents of broader immigration policies.
In Italy, where discussions on immigration have become more divided, Meloni’s remarks indicate her political stance clearly. She tries to connect immigration with violence against women in order to attract voters worried about increasing crime and who believe immigration contributes significantly to societal unrest.
However, her detractors claim that this method simplifies intricate social problems and does not provide effective solutions. They emphasize the need for a comprehensive approach to addressing violence against women, which includes strengthening law enforcement, promoting gender equality through education, and enhancing support services for survivors of violence. Arguing that concentrating on ethnicity or immigration status takes attention away from these better long-term solutions.
